I believe this is because if libcurl fails to parse/accept the proxy string it won't get set and then it runs without proxy. I think that is the correct behavior, but you should of course get an error code back when you used setopt() to set that proxy. Did you?

We didn't get any error when setopt() is used to set the invalid proxy, it always returns CURLE_OK.

Yes, right. I was being stupid - setopt() basically only copies the string and does no parsing whatsoever. I could repeat your problem and I've now pushed a fix for this with an associated test case (1329). Thanks for reporting!
